Yuanling Yuan
Yuanling Yuan (born 3 June 1994) is a Canadians, Canadian chess player and entrepreneur. She was awarded the title of FIDE titles#Woman International Master (WIM), Woman International Master (WIM) by FIDE in 2009. Yuan competed in the Women's World Chess Championship in 2015 and represented Canada five times at the Women's Chess Olympiad (38th Chess Olympiad, 2008, 39th Chess Olympiad, 2010, 40th Chess Olympiad, 2012, 41st Chess Olympiad, 2014 and 42nd Chess Olympiad, 2016). Biography Born in Shanghai, Yuanling Yuan moved to Canada with her family when she was five years old. While in Ottawa she was playing for the RA Chess Club, but when she moved to Toronto she joined the Scarborough Chess Club. She attended Victoria Park Collegiate Institute from 2008 to 2012, completing the International Baccalaureate program in high school. Shanghai
Shanghai (; , , Standard Mandarin pronunciation: ) is one of the four direct-administered municipalities of the People's Republic of China (PRC). The city is located on the southern estuary of the Yangtze River, with the Huangpu River flowing through it. With a population of 24.89 million as of 2021, Shanghai is the most populous urban area in China with 39,300,000 inhabitants living in the Shanghai metropolitan area, the second most populous city proper in the world (after Chongqing) and the only city in East Asia with a GDP greater than its corresponding capital. Shanghai ranks second among the administrative divisions of Mainland China in human development index (after Beijing). As of 2018, the Greater Shanghai metropolitan area was estimated to produce a gross metropolitan product (nominal) of nearly 9.1 trillion RMB ($1.33 trillion), exceeding that of Mexico with GDP of $1.22 trillion, the 15th largest in the world.
